Ihor Banadiga

JavaDay Lviv, CoffeeJug, KotLand organizer, leader of Lviv JavaClub, speaker, and JUG UA active member.

Solid knowledge of OOP concepts, development patterns, and software engineering practices. Strong knowledge of Java and the JVM ecosystem. Experienced in software architecture, microservices component design, security, and cloud solutions. Follow modern development practices, always pay attention to code quality, and prefer the TDD approach

What I Do

Software engineering

I have taken part in the full life cycle of software development projects of various sizes, including application design from scratch, bootstrapping, prototyping, analyzing and fixing memory leaks, providing performance improvements and JVM tunings, code refactoring, and optimization, porting, and re-design software to another platform.




Development of the Java community of Lviv and Ukraine